‘Ant-Man’ teased with new ‘behind the scene photo’ dropped by Edgar Wright
Edgar Wright has teased Ant-Man with a new photo. The behind the scene image, assumed to be from the set of his previous test reel, shows the hero in costume during filming.
“Now I’m back in LA, it’s high time to finish a little something I’ve been working on…” wrote Wright on Twitter.
He revealed in July that the script for the long-awaited Marvel Studios film had been completed.
No castings have been confirmed for the film.
The release of Ant-Man was recently moved forward to July 31, 2015.
Little is known of the story, but the Avengers villain Ultron is not part of the story. Protagonist Hank Pym had a hand in creating the character in the Marvel Comics source material, but the Avengers 2 film arrives in May of 2015.
Attack the Block writer Joe Cornish is writing the script.
